An Alternative Formulae for the Net Present Value (NPV)
Journal Title: JOURNAL OF ADVANCES IN MATHEMATICS - Year 2016, Vol 12, Issue 2
Abstract
An alternative formulae is derived for NPV. First, the equivalence of NPV formulae and the value of a special portfolio is shown and weights of special portfolio is derived by minimizing the variance of portfolio.
